Raw Power Games revealed new gameplay details for Chronicles: Medieval during the Summer Game Fest 2026 presentation. The studio focused on large-scale battle mechanics and confirmed an early access launch window.

Large-scale battles feature hundreds of soldiers with commander-led combat and a five-state morale system.
The title arrives as a medieval role-playing game that blends deep RPG systems with sandbox storytelling. Developers compare its narrative approach to Crusader Kings 3 while borrowing combat depth from Kingdom Come Deliverance 2.
Battles deploy hundreds of soldiers across the field using battle line formations. Players take direct command on the ground, leading units through commander-led engagements rather than issuing remote orders.
The game tracks unit morale across five distinct states ranging from inspired to broken. Only direct kills performed by the player can inspire nearby troops and shift their status upward.
Chronicles: Medieval will enter early access on Steam in 2026. The build includes extensive modding support integrated directly into the core systems.
